Blueberry Strawberry Pavlova
- 3 egg whites room temperature
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on white vinegar
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la
- 1 teaspoon cornstarch
- 1 cup blueberries
- 1 cup strawberries sliced
- 1 cup heavy cream
- confectioners' sugar for dusting
- Grease and lightly flour a cookie sheet. Make an 8" circle on the sheet.
- Beat egg whites in bowl until soft peaks begin to form. Gradually beat in s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time and salt. Add vinegar and vanilla and beat until stiff peaks form.
- Sift cornstarch over the meringue; fold in. Spread on cookie sheet within marked circle; spoon higher on sides to form hollow.
- Bake in preheated very slow oven, 250 degrees, for 1 hour. Turn off oven; do not open oven door, leave meringue in oven 3 to 4 hours or until cool. Loosen from sheet with long spatula. Place on serving dish.
- Fill meringue with berries.
- Beat heavy cream and 1 tablespoon sugar until stiff. Pipe cream over fruit. Dust lightly with confectioners' sugar.
